Supai is the village located in the canyon.  A few hundred people live here year round.  It seems that more horses and dogs live here than people.  Supai has a few facilities geared towards the tourist.  There's a cafe that serves standard greasy-spoon type food.  There's a post office for sending letters by mule train.  The general store has a reasonable supply of basic essentials that one might need.
